Siding installation services involve attaching new exterior wall coverings to a property to improve its appearance, protect it from the elements, and enhance energy efficiency. This process typically includes removing any existing siding, preparing the surface, and carefully installing the chosen material to ensure durability and a clean look. Homeowners seeking to update their home's exterior or replace damaged siding often turn to local contractors who specialize in siding installation to achieve a professional finish that lasts for years.
One common reason homeowners consider siding installation is to address issues such as weather-related damage, including cracking, warping, or rotting of existing siding materials.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and pests can compromise the integrity of siding, leading to increased energy costs and potential structural problems. Installing new siding helps solve these issues by providing a protective barrier that resists moisture infiltration, reduces drafts, and prevents further deterioration, ultimately saving money on repairs and energy bills.

The overview below groups typical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oak Grove,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s, such as replacing a few damaged panels or fixing loose siding,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more extensive fixes.
Partial Siding Replacement - When only part of a home’s siding needs replacement, local contractors often charge between $1,500 and $4,000. Larger, more complex partial replacements can push costs higher, especially for multi-story or custom siding materials.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ding overhauls for homes in Oak Grove typically cost between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and material choices. Many full replacements fall into the mid-range, with larger or high-end projects reaching the upper tiers.
Material and Design Considerations - The choice of siding material, such as vinyl, fiber cement, or wood, influences costs, with basic options starting around $3 per square foot and premium materials exceeding $10. Design complexity and home size can also impact overall pricing, with more elaborate styles generally costing more.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of siding materials can local contractors install? Local siding installation service providers typically work with a variety of materials including v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and aluminum to meet different preferences and needs.
How do I know if my home is suitable for siding replacement? A professional contractor can assess the condition of existing siding and determine if replacement or repairs are necessary based on factors like damage, age, and structural integrity.
What preparations are needed before siding installation begins? Contractors usually recommend clearing the work area, removing any obstacles, and ensuring access to the exterior of the home to facilitate a smooth installation process.
Are there different siding styles available to match my home's architecture? Yes, local service providers often offer various styles such as horizontal, vertical, shake, or board-and-batten to complement different architectural designs.
What maintenance is required after siding installation? Maintenance requirements depend on the siding material but generally include periodic cleaning and inspections to ensure longevity and appearance.
